- 博客(2)
- 收藏
- 关注
原创 样例1 (2)
一个安卓练手例题1: 模拟器运行结果——》 勇杰尼龟打开,并且打开安卓配置文件如下图 程序入口界面找到 后直接进去看 找到 了点击事件监听器 逻辑差不多为,输入不为空则调用NI的greyolf方法,以此来判断输入是否正确。 接下来分析so层 打开ida,我们输出函数界面,ctrl+f 搜索java_ 没有结果,那基本可以肯定这个apk是采用的JNIload 动态注册 我们在函数输出界面搜索JNIload 进入该函数 获取 TracerPid 的值,这也是一个反调试逻辑,我们只需要 在这.
2020-09-28 00:01:19 719 1
原创 逆向入门,一个变形程序的逆向过程。
记录教程的课后作业心路。 要求去掉该程序的nag窗口。 先运行一遍查看情况。 首先试试最简单的办法,字符串查找大法。 很简单就找到了我们想要的字符串。 就在开始的下面,直接上断点爆破试试。 但是在单步调试的时候,发现出现nag窗口时,程序并没有经过这个函数。 **就知道没这么容易,这个字符串就是个幌子而已。 ** 那我就试试,查看它调用了哪些函数吧,但是下了断点却报错了。 只好慢慢来了...
2019-06-22 05:40:28 1280
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人